Transaction 70289559ce37a7510e59533f132a8a695dbe58f1763ca995b1bd65688e8a9a35

1 Input
2 Outputs
  • 70289559ce37a7510e59533f132a8a695dbe58f1763ca995b1bd65688e8a9a35:0
  • value  1252591
    address  3KrP9LHGuHLQDSw53GYCGC29gAduKKnec7
  • 70289559ce37a7510e59533f132a8a695dbe58f1763ca995b1bd65688e8a9a35:1
  • value  1461241
    address  17dtLodtUtnrTxCzTEav75JBTRkfzu3YuN